《《软件开发》课程设计任务书.docx》由会员分享,可在线阅读,更多相关《《软件开发》课程设计任务书.docx(7页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、软件开发课程设计任务书 软件开发课程设计任务书 适用专业:计算机科学与技术 课内学时:40开课学期:7 一、课程设计大纲说明 (一)课程设计的性质和目的 课程设计是学生理论联系实际的重要实践教学环节,是对学生进行的一次综合性专业设计训练。通过课程设计使学生获得以下几方面能力,为毕业设计(论文)打基础。 1、进一步巩固和加深学生对所学相关课程理论知识的理解,培养学生设计计算、软件编程、计算 机应用、文献查阅、报告撰写等基本技能。 2、培养学生实践动手能力及独立分析和解决工程实际问题的能力。 3、培养学生创新意识、严肃认真的治学态度和理论联系实际的工作作风。 (二)课程设计的基本要求 1、要求熟悉
2、软件开发的基本思路和基本流程,掌握RAD或网络开发平台以及相关专业知识的应用。 2、每位学生要根据所接受的任务书,实事求是保质保量地独立完成设计任务。对有抄袭他人设计 论文、找人代做或从网上下载等行为的弄虚作假者,课程设计成绩按不及格论处。 3、每位学生要遵守学习纪律,保证出勤,不得迟到、早退。每天出勤不少于4小时,因事、因病 不能上课需请假。严禁在机房内打闹、嬉戏、吸烟、打扑克、玩游戏及上网聊天等不良行为。 (三)本课程设计与其他相关课程的关系 本课程设计是对已学专业知识的综合与深化,并为后续课程的学习创造有利的条件。 二、课程设计内容及学时分配 (一)课程设计内容 1、县水利局公文管理系统
3、 1) 软件功能: 公文的自动生成;公文查询;公文存档 公文的自动生成:能按照现有的公文格式自动在WORD中生成所需公文。公文包括红头文 件,取水证书,水政执法和其他公文四种类型。具体公文格式可参阅相关公文模板,在我的 教学主页上可直接下载。 /slhu 公文查询:根据发文编号,发文标题和发文标识实现组合查询。当查询到具体公文时要能够 浏览其详细内容。 公文存档:将生成公文信息存入数据库。表的结构至少包括以下字段:公文编号,发文标识, 发文标题,文档存储位置和发文日期。保持记录时能根据公文编号来识别记录,即公文编号 不能相同。 公文编号由年和发文号组成。如202212表示2022年12号文。
4、发文标识分为凤水政,凤水政函和其他三种类型。 2)要求:设计合理,功能完善,界面美观,操作简便。 3) 技术难点:如何使用使用开发工具对WORD进行调用和操作。 2、田家庵区教委学生成绩管理系统 1)软件功能: 成绩导入:将上报的EXCEL表格成绩内容导入ACCESS数据库。EXCEL成绩表格的格式 可以从我的主页上下载。 /slhu 课程管理:实现考试课程的添加,删除和修改 学校管理:实现考试学校的添加,删除和修改 成绩查询:根据学校,学生姓名,考试科目等实现信息查询。 成绩分析:对某一个学校,可根据所在学校,考试类型,课程名称和学期等条件实现学校单科成绩排序,学生各科总分排序和学生个人成绩
5、查询三个子功能。对不同学校可根据所在学期,考试类型和课程名称等条件实现单科分数排序和各科总分排序。同时根据单科分数或总分分数,可以查看名次分布。如显示语文前10名的学生姓名。 成绩打印:将查询和排序的结果打印出来。 2)要求:设计合理,功能完善,界面美观,操作简便。 3) 技术难点:熟练掌握SQL语言在ACCESS中的使用和EXCEL数据如何导入到ACCESS 中。 3、超市管理系统 1)软件功能: 商品管理:商品的添加、删除、修改。 商品报表:打印相关查询信息。 销售商品:并提供库存判断、找零计算等功能。 查询商品:通过货物编号,商品名称和时间等条件实现商品销售查询,销量统计和查询库存情况,
6、并且对每个月,每个季度和每年的销售情况以图形方式显示,如柱状图等。 打印功能:对查询的相关信息实现打印功能。 今日盘点:告诉用户今日的销售总额是多少,各类商品的销售额是多少。 2)要求:设计合理,功能完善,界面美观,使用灵活。 4、高校学生综合测评系统 1)软件功能: 信息输入:为用户提供一个交互式的应用界面,使用户可以通过该界面输入系统需要的各种参数,并将输入的参数保存到相对应的数据库文件中,同时还可以对已经输入的参数进行修改。如学生成绩的输入或综合测评公式的参数输入等。对于学生成绩的输入,应该提供手工输入和成绩导入两种方法。其中成绩导入的要求同题目2中的要求相同。 综合测评:根据录入信息,
7、按照学生综合测评实施办法,运用数学的计算方法求出学生本学年的综合测评成绩以及在班级中的名次,并逻辑推理判断出学生的奖学金级别以及荣誉称号。 信息查询:系统具备条件检索查询功能,可以根据用户的需求进行信息查询、定制查询结果。 打印输出:系统具备打印输出功能,可以根据用户的需求进行打印输出。 2)要求:设计合理,功能完善,页面美观,操作简便。 3) 技术难点:EXCEL数据如何导入到ACCESS中。 5、计算机学院党员管理系统 1)软件功能: 基本信息管理:包括对党员,党总支和党支部的管理。如添加,删除和修改信息等。党员的基本信息中必须包括党员照片信息。 信息查询:可根据相关条件实现信息的综合查询
8、。如姓名,党支部等。对单个党员包括其基本信息,奖惩情况和组织活动情况。对党支部包括党员人数,发展党员的情况和奖惩情况等。 信息打印: 对查询的信息实现打印功能。 缴纳党费:单个党员的缴费登记和缴费情况。党支部党费缴纳情况,如缴纳总额,缺交人数等。 党员流出:实现党员转组织关系。 2)要求:设计合理,功能完善,页面美观,操作简便。 3) 技术难点:综合查询的实现和界面的友好性。 5、我的相册 1)软件功能: 背景音乐:浏览相片时可播放音乐。 图形管理:对浏览的图片可放大和缩小。注意:图片为BMP格式。 图形特效:对浏览的图片可生成特效功能。至少包括以下特效:从上飞入和从下飞入,百叶窗效果(水平和垂直),从中间扩散等。自己可定义其他特效。 图形处理:包括颜色反转,颠倒图形,水平镜像和垂直镜像 2)要求:设计合理,功能完善,页面美观,操作简便。 3) 技术难点:特效的生成。 (二)时间安排 软件设计与开发安排28学时;撰写课程设计论文安排10学时;组织答辩安排2学时。和设计相关的材料会及时在主页上链接,请关注! 编写人:胡胜利 审定人:张顺香 编写日期:2022年12月16日